/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/data/ |
D | PermGroupsPackagesUiInfoLiveData.kt | 75 val getLiveData = { groupName: String -> SinglePermGroupPackagesUiInfoLiveData[groupName] } in <lambda>() method 85 groupName: String, in <lambda>() 123 return PermGroupPackagesUiInfo(groupName, nonSystem, grantedNonSystem, in <lambda>() 146 for (groupName in groupNames) { in <lambda>() method 147 allPackageData[groupName] = if (haveAllLiveDatas && allInitialized) { in <lambda>() 148 permGroupPackagesLiveDatas[groupName]?.value?.let { uiInfo -> in <lambda>() 149 createPermGroupPackageUiInfo(groupName, uiInfo) in <lambda>() 164 for ((idx, groupName) in groupNames.withIndex()) { in <lambda>() method 165 if (groupName != firstLoadGroup) { in <lambda>() 166 addLiveDataDelayed(groupName, idx * STAGGER_LOAD_TIME_MS) in <lambda>() [all …]
|
D | PermGroupLiveData.kt | 41 private val groupName: String in <lambda>() constant in com.android.permissioncontroller.permission.data.PermGroupLiveData 72 groupInfo = Utils.getGroupInfo(groupName, context) ?: run { in <lambda>() 73 Log.e(LOG_TAG, "Invalid permission group $groupName") in <lambda>() 74 invalidateSingle(groupName) in <lambda>() 83 groupName) in <lambda>() 85 Log.e(LOG_TAG, "Invalid permission group $groupName") in <lambda>() 86 invalidateSingle(groupName) in <lambda>()
|
D | PermGroupsPackagesLiveData.kt | 48 val getLiveData = { groupName: String -> PermGroupLiveData[groupName] } in <lambda>() method 76 for (groupName in groupNames) { in <lambda>() constant 77 val permGroup = permGroupLiveDatas[groupName]?.value in <lambda>() 82 groupApps[groupName] = mutableSetOf() in <lambda>()
|
D | PackagePermissionsLiveData.kt | 61 var groupName = PermissionMapping.getGroupOfPlatformPermission(permName) in loadDataAndPostValue() variable 62 if (groupName == null) { in loadDataAndPostValue() 96 groupName = PermissionMapping.getGroupOfPermission(permInfo) ?: permName in loadDataAndPostValue() 99 permissionMap.getOrPut(groupName) { mutableListOf() }.add(permName) in loadDataAndPostValue()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/model/ |
D | AppPermissionGroupsViewModel.kt | 94 val groupName: String, in <lambda>() constant in com.android.permissioncontroller.permission.ui.model.AppPermissionGroupsViewModel.GroupUiInfo 98 constructor(groupName: String, isSystem: Boolean) : in <lambda>() 99 this(groupName, isSystem, PermSubtitle.NONE) in <lambda>() 142 val getLiveData = { groupName: String -> in <lambda>() method 143 AppPermGroupUiInfoLiveData[packageName, groupName, user] in <lambda>() 161 for (groupName in groups) { in <lambda>() method 162 val isSystem = PermissionMapping.getPlatformPermissionGroups().contains(groupName) in <lambda>() 163 appPermGroupUiInfoLiveDatas[groupName]?.value?.let { uiInfo -> in <lambda>() 167 if (groupName == Manifest.permission_group.STORAGE && in <lambda>() 170 GroupUiInfo(groupName, isSystem, PermSubtitle.ALL_FILES)) in <lambda>() [all …]
|
D | GrantPermissionsViewModel.kt | 199 val groupName = groupInfo.name in <lambda>() constant 276 val getLiveDataFun = { groupName: String -> in <lambda>() method 277 LightAppPermGroupLiveData[packageName, groupName, user] in <lambda>() 287 for ((groupName, groupLiveData) in appPermGroupLiveDatas) { in <lambda>() variable 289 if (appPermGroup == null || groupName in permGroupsToSkip) { in <lambda>() 291 Log.e(LOG_TAG, "Group $packageName $groupName invalid") in <lambda>() 293 groupStates[groupName to true]?.state = STATE_SKIPPED in <lambda>() 294 groupStates[groupName to false]?.state = STATE_SKIPPED in <lambda>() 300 val states = groupStates.filter { it.key.first == groupName } in <lambda>() 327 val (groupName, isBackground) = key in <lambda>() constant [all …]
|
D | PermissionAppsViewModel.kt | 81 private val groupName: String in <lambda>() constant in com.android.permissioncontroller.permission.ui.model.PermissionAppsViewModel 96 val categorizedAppsLiveData = CategorizedAppsLiveData(groupName) in <lambda>() 120 val sensor = Utils.getSensorCode(groupName) in <lambda>() 121 val isLocation = LOCATION.equals(groupName) in <lambda>() 173 inner class CategorizedAppsLiveData(groupName: String) : in <lambda>() 176 private val packagesUiInfoLiveData = SinglePermGroupPackagesUiInfoLiveData[groupName] in <lambda>() 183 if (groupName == Manifest.permission_group.STORAGE) { in <lambda>() 257 if (!SdkLevel.isAtLeastT() && groupName == Manifest.permission_group.STORAGE && in <lambda>() 317 activity, groupName, packageName)) { in <lambda>() 325 activity, groupName, packageName)) { in <lambda>() [all …]
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/model/v31/ |
D | PermissionUsageControlPreferenceUtils.kt | 49 groupName: String, in initPreference() 55 val permGroupLabel = KotlinUtils.getPermGroupLabel(context, groupName) in initPreference() 58 icon = KotlinUtils.getPermGroupIcon(context, groupName) in initPreference() 73 } else if (SENSOR_DATA_PERMISSIONS.contains(groupName)) { in initPreference() 76 intent.putExtra(Intent.EXTRA_PERMISSION_GROUP_NAME, groupName) in initPreference() 79 logSensorDataTimelineViewed(groupName, sessionId) in initPreference() 86 intent.putExtra(Intent.EXTRA_PERMISSION_GROUP_NAME, groupName) in initPreference() 94 private fun logSensorDataTimelineViewed(groupName: String, sessionId: Long) { in logSensorDataTimelineViewed() 95 val act = when (groupName) { in logSensorDataTimelineViewed()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/legacy/ |
D | AppPermissionActivity.java | 99 String groupName = getIntent().getStringExtra(Intent.EXTRA_PERMISSION_GROUP_NAME); in onCreate() local 100 if (permissionName == null && groupName == null) { in onCreate() 106 if (groupName == null) { in onCreate() 107 groupName = PermissionMapping.getGroupOfPlatformPermission(permissionName); in onCreate() 116 groupName = permission.group; in onCreate() 122 groupName = null; in onCreate() 133 if (LocationUtils.isLocationGroupAndProvider(this, groupName, in onCreate() 143 this, groupName, packageName)) { in onCreate() 159 groupName, userHandle, sessionId); in onCreate() 167 packageName, permissionName, groupName, userHandle, null, 0, null)); in onCreate()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/service/ |
D | AutoRevokePermissions.kt | 105 for (groupName in pkgPermGroups.keys) { in <lambda>() constant 106 if (groupName == PackagePermissionsLiveData.NON_RUNTIME_NORMAL_PERMS) { in <lambda>() 109 if (groupName !in PermissionMapping.getPlatformPermissionGroups()) { in <lambda>() 113 LightAppPermGroupLiveData[packageName, groupName, user] in <lambda>() 124 revocableGroups.add(groupName) in <lambda>() 138 for (groupName in pkgPermGroups.keys) { in <lambda>() 139 if (!revocableGroups.contains(groupName)) { in <lambda>() 141 splitPermissionIndex.getGroupToGroupSplitsTo(groupName, targetSdk)) { in <lambda>() 145 splitPermissionIndex.getGroupToGroupSplitsFrom(groupName, targetSdk)) { in <lambda>() 155 .forEachInParallel(Main) forEachInParallelInner@ { (groupName, _) -> in <lambda>() method [all …]
|
D | PermissionSearchIndexablesProvider.java | 57 String groupName = permissionGroupNames.get(i); in queryRawData() local 59 CharSequence label = getPermissionGroupLabel(groupName, pm); in queryRawData() 65 .add(COLUMN_KEY, createRawDataKey(groupName, context)) in queryRawData() 73 private CharSequence getPermissionGroupLabel(String groupName, PackageManager pm) { in getPermissionGroupLabel() argument 75 return pm.getPermissionGroupInfo(groupName, 0).loadLabel(pm); in getPermissionGroupLabel() 77 Log.w(LOG_TAG, "Cannot find group label for " + groupName, e); in getPermissionGroupLabel()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/utils/ |
D | Utils.java | 509 public static @Nullable PackageItemInfo getGroupInfo(@NonNull String groupName, in getGroupInfo() argument 512 return context.getPackageManager().getPermissionGroupInfo(groupName, 0); in getGroupInfo() 517 return context.getPackageManager().getPermissionInfo(groupName, 0); in getGroupInfo() 533 public static @Nullable List<PermissionInfo> getGroupPermissionInfos(@NonNull String groupName, in getGroupPermissionInfos() argument 536 return Utils.getPermissionInfosForGroup(context.getPackageManager(), groupName); in getGroupPermissionInfos() 542 .getPermissionInfo(groupName, 0); in getGroupPermissionInfos() 705 String groupName, Context context, @StringRes int requestRes) { in getRequestMessage() argument 713 if (groupName.equals(STORAGE) && isIsolatedStorage) { in getRequestMessage() 723 loadGroupDescription(context, groupName, context.getPackageManager())), 0); in getRequestMessage() 726 private static CharSequence loadGroupDescription(Context context, String groupName, in loadGroupDescription() argument [all …]
|
D | LocationUtils.java | 92 public static boolean isLocationGroupAndProvider(Context context, String groupName, in isLocationGroupAndProvider() argument 94 return LOCATION_PERMISSION.equals(groupName) && isLocationProvider(context, packageName); in isLocationGroupAndProvider() 98 @NonNull String groupName, @NonNull String packageName) { in isLocationGroupAndControllerExtraPackage() argument 99 return (LOCATION_PERMISSION.equals(groupName) in isLocationGroupAndControllerExtraPackage() 100 || ACTIVITY_RECOGNITION_PERMISSION.equals(groupName)) in isLocationGroupAndControllerExtraPackage()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/handheld/ |
D | AllAppPermissionsFragment.java | 187 for (String groupName : groupMap.keySet()) { in updateUi() 188 List<String> permissions = groupMap.get(groupName); in updateUi() 193 PreferenceGroup pref = findOrCreatePrefGroup(groupName); in updateUi() 195 pref.addPreference(getPreference(permName, groupName)); in updateUi() 226 private PreferenceGroup findOrCreatePrefGroup(String groupName) { in findOrCreatePrefGroup() argument 227 if (groupName.equals(PackagePermissionsLiveData.NON_RUNTIME_NORMAL_PERMS)) { in findOrCreatePrefGroup() 230 PreferenceGroup pref = findPreference(groupName); in findOrCreatePrefGroup() 233 pref.setKey(groupName); in findOrCreatePrefGroup() 234 pref.setTitle(KotlinUtils.INSTANCE.getPermGroupLabel(getContext(), groupName)); in findOrCreatePrefGroup() local 242 private Preference getPreference(String permName, String groupName) { in getPreference() argument [all …]
|
D | GrantPermissionsViewHandlerImpl.kt | 92 private var groupName: String? = null variable in com.android.permissioncontroller.permission.ui.handheld.GrantPermissionsViewHandlerImpl 121 arguments.putString(ARG_GROUP_NAME, groupName) in saveInstanceState() 135 groupName = savedInstanceState.getString(ARG_GROUP_NAME) in loadInstanceState() 152 groupName: String?, in updateUi() 163 this.groupName = groupName in updateUi() 250 if (groupName != null) { in createView() 437 resultListener.onPermissionRationaleClicked(groupName) in onClick() 464 resultListener.onPermissionGrantResult(groupName, CANCELED) in onClick() 487 resultListener.onPermissionGrantResult(groupName, affectedForegroundPermissions, in onClick() 493 resultListener.onPermissionGrantResult(groupName, affectedForegroundPermissions, in onClick() [all …]
|
D | ManagePermissionsFragment.java | 114 for (String groupName : mPermissionGroups.keySet()) { in updatePermissionsUi() 116 PermGroupPackagesUiInfo group = mPermissionGroups.get(groupName); in updatePermissionsUi() 118 Preference preference = findPreference(groupName); in updatePermissionsUi() 123 preference.setKey(groupName); in updatePermissionsUi() 125 KotlinUtils.INSTANCE.getPermGroupIcon(context, groupName), in updatePermissionsUi() 127 preference.setTitle(KotlinUtils.INSTANCE.getPermGroupLabel(context, groupName)); in updatePermissionsUi()
|
/packages/apps/Contacts/src/com/android/contacts/group/ |
D | GroupMetaData.java | 52 public final String groupName; field in GroupMetaData 77 this.groupName = cursor.getString(GroupMetaDataLoader.TITLE); in GroupMetaData() 94 groupName = source.readString(); in GroupMetaData() 108 dest.writeString(groupName); in writeToParcel() 117 return uri != null && !TextUtils.isEmpty(groupName) && groupId > 0; in isValid() 132 .add("groupName", groupName) in toString()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/handheld/v34/ |
D | PermissionRationaleViewHandlerImpl.kt | 52 private var groupName: String? = null variable in com.android.permissioncontroller.permission.ui.handheld.v34.PermissionRationaleViewHandlerImpl 70 outState.putString(ARG_GROUP_NAME, groupName) in saveInstanceState() 80 groupName = savedInstanceState.getString(ARG_GROUP_NAME) in loadInstanceState() 91 groupName: String, in updateUi() 99 this.groupName = groupName in updateUi() 174 if (groupName != null) { in createView() 199 resultListener.onPermissionRationaleResult(groupName, CANCELLED) in onCancelled()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/ |
D | GrantPermissionsViewHandler.java | 58 void onPermissionGrantResult(String groupName, @Result int result); in onPermissionGrantResult() argument 60 void onPermissionGrantResult(String groupName, List<String> affectedForegroundPermissions, in onPermissionGrantResult() argument 63 void onPermissionRationaleClicked(String groupName); in onPermissionRationaleClicked() argument 98 void updateUi(String groupName, int groupCount, int groupIndex, Icon icon, in updateUi() argument
|
D | ManagePermissionsActivity.java | 243 String groupName = getIntent() in onCreate() local 251 groupName, showSystem, sessionId); in onCreate() 254 .newInstance(groupName, Long.MAX_VALUE, showSystem, sessionId, in onCreate() 276 String groupName = getIntent().getStringExtra(Intent.EXTRA_PERMISSION_GROUP_NAME); in onCreate() local 278 if (permissionName == null && groupName == null) { in onCreate() 288 if (groupName == null) { in onCreate() 289 groupName = getGroupFromPermission(permissionName); in onCreate() 292 if (groupName != null in onCreate() 293 && groupName.equals(Manifest.permission_group.NOTIFICATIONS)) { in onCreate() 301 groupName, userHandle, caller, sessionId, null); in onCreate()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/safetycenter/ui/ |
D | SafetyCenterQsFragment.java | 568 for (String groupName : TOGGLE_BUTTONS) { 570 !sensorStates.containsKey(groupName) 571 || sensorStates.get(groupName).getVisible(); 576 addToggle(groupName, row); 641 for (String groupName : TOGGLE_BUTTONS) { 642 View toggle = rootView.findViewWithTag(groupName); 647 sensorStates.containsKey(groupName) 648 ? sensorStates.get(groupName).getAdmin() 661 mViewModel.toggleSensor(groupName); 666 Sensor.fromPermissionGroupName(groupName)); [all …]
|
/packages/services/Car/service/src/com/android/car/audio/ |
D | CoreAudioHelper.java | 175 public static AudioVolumeGroup getVolumeGroup(String groupName) { in getVolumeGroup() argument 179 Slogf.d(TAG, "requested %s has %s,", groupName, group); in getVolumeGroup() 181 if (group.name().equals(groupName)) { in getVolumeGroup() 199 public static AudioAttributes selectAttributesForVolumeGroupName(String groupName) { in selectAttributesForVolumeGroupName() argument 200 AudioVolumeGroup group = getVolumeGroup(groupName); in selectAttributesForVolumeGroupName()
|
D | CoreAudioVolumeGroupCallback.java | 64 String groupName = CoreAudioHelper.getVolumeGroupNameFromCoreId(groupId); in onAudioVolumeGroupChanged() local 65 if (groupName == null) { in onAudioVolumeGroupChanged() 69 mCarVolumeInfoWrapper.onAudioVolumeGroupChanged(zoneId, groupName, flags); in onAudioVolumeGroupChanged()
|
/packages/modules/OnDevicePersonalization/src/com/android/ondevicepersonalization/services/download/mdd/ |
D | OnDevicePersonalizationFileGroupPopulator.java | 70 String groupName, in createDataFileGroup() argument 87 .setGroupName(groupName) in createDataFileGroup() 183 String groupName = createPackageFileGroupName( in refreshFileGroups() local 186 fileGroupsToRemove.remove(groupName); in refreshFileGroups() 188 String fileId = groupName; in refreshFileGroups() 197 groupName, in refreshFileGroups()
|
/packages/modules/Permission/PermissionController/src/com/android/permissioncontroller/permission/ui/handheld/v31/ |
D | PermissionDetailsWrapperFragment.java | 47 public static @NonNull PermissionDetailsWrapperFragment newInstance(@Nullable String groupName, in newInstance() argument 51 if (groupName != null) { in newInstance() 52 arguments.putString(Intent.EXTRA_PERMISSION_GROUP_NAME, groupName); in newInstance()
|